Agreements

The Agreements page shows service agreements from your IT provider. These may include terms of service, service level agreements (SLAs), or other contracts that outline the services you receive.

Agreements Page


What You'll See

Each agreement in the list shows:

  • Agreement title — The name of the agreement
  • Version — Version number (e.g., v1, v2)
  • Date — When the agreement was sent, viewed, or signed
  • Status — Current state of the agreement

Agreement Statuses

StatusWhat It Means
PendingThe agreement has been sent to you but not yet reviewed
ViewedYou've opened and looked at the agreement
SignedYou've reviewed and signed the agreement
DeclinedYou've declined the agreement

Reviewing an Agreement

  1. Click on any agreement in the list
  2. The full agreement text opens in a dialog
  3. Read through the agreement carefully
  4. You may be asked to sign or acknowledge the agreement

Signing an Agreement

When you're ready to accept an agreement:

  1. Open the agreement by clicking on it
  2. Read the full text
  3. Click the Sign or Accept button
  4. Your signature and timestamp are recorded
  5. The status changes to "Signed"

If You See "No Agreements"

This means your IT provider hasn't sent you any agreements yet. When they do, they'll appear here automatically.


Common Questions

Can I decline an agreement?

Contact your IT provider to discuss any concerns about agreement terms before declining.

Can I re-read a signed agreement?

Yes — click on any agreement (including signed ones) to view the full text at any time.

What if I have questions about the agreement?

Submit a support ticket or contact your IT provider directly to discuss agreement terms.
